Key Points

  • The Swachh Vayu Survekshan awards rank cities on their progress in improving air quality under the National Clean Air Programme (NCAP), and are presented on the International Day of Clean Air for Blue Skies (7 September).
  • Cities are assessed in three population categories, and in the 2025 edition the first ranks were:
    • Category 1 (population above 10 lakh) — Indore, with a full score of 200 out of 200.
    • Category 2 (population between 3 and 10 lakh) — Amravati.
    • Category 3 (population under 3 lakh) — Dewas.
  • All three statements are therefore correct.

Additional Information

  • National Clean Air Programme (NCAP):
    • Launched in January 2019 by the Ministry of Environment, Forest and Climate Change.
    • Originally targeted a 20–30% reduction in PM2.5 and PM10 concentrations by 2024 against a 2017 baseline; the target was later revised to a 40% reduction by 2025–26.
    • Covers 131 non-attainment cities that consistently failed to meet the National Ambient Air Quality Standards over five years.
  • Assessment parameters include control of solid waste and biomass burning, road dust management, vehicular and industrial emissions, and public awareness.
  • Indore's record is notable — it has also topped the Swachh Survekshan cleanliness rankings for several consecutive years.
